Will my flowers change colors?
Yes, most blooms change color when pressed and continue to change color within the frame over time. Solidago Studios uses UV protected glass to minimize color changing and fading. Pressing flowers is a natural art, therefore there will be some fading over time. If you have questions feel free to send them our way by emailing courtney@solidagostudios.com

What are flowers that preserve really well?
Greenery, roses, ranunculus, stock, larkspur, delphinium, anemones, hydrangea, hellebores, etc. We can press all different types of flowers. Have a question about building a bouquet perfect for preservation? Shoot us an email courtney@solidagostudios.com
What are flowers that don't preserve well?
While we can press any flower, there are a few types that tend to yellow or brown more than an average flower. These include: white lisianthus, lilies, and chrysanthemums. We will still press these flowers if they are in your bouquet, and once you receive your design proposal you can decide if you want them included or not. Have any questions?
